MBAC.WS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2021 in Review

45 of the 5,728 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in M3-Brigade Acquisition II Corp. Redeemable Warrants, each whole warrant exercisable for one share of Class A common stock at an exercise price of $11.50 (MBAC.WS) for Q3 2021, worth a combined $17.8M — up 50% from $11.8M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 16 funds opened new MBAC.WS positions and 7 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 8 added to existing stakes and 5 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Magnetar Financial, opening a new position worth an estimated $565K. The largest seller was Nomura Holdings, cutting an estimated $746K.
